Summary
KANN MANUFACTURING CORPORATION has accumulated 36 OSHA violations across 8 inspections over 40 years of recorded history, with $4,980 in total assessed penalties.
The establishment sits in the 81st perc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 74 employers. Inspection frequency runs at the 82nd percentile.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 13 years ago.
